Two charged particles have charges and masses in the ratio 2:3 and 1:4 respectively. If they enter a uniform magnetic field and move with the same velocity, then the ratio of their respective time periods of revolution is
Options
(a) (3:8)
(b) (1:4)
(c) (3:5)
(d) (1:6)
Correct Answer:
(3:8)
